5.1: "No Balls & Two Strikes"

[This synopsis is editted from a version by Audrey DeLisle ([email protected]).]
Lucius Carabella (Marco Rodriguez) is released from prison and has thoughts of killing those that testified against him. He meets up with Marshall Dutch Dixon, who has a similar goal, and Dixon enrolls the bounty to help. Meanwhile, Sandy Carruthers (new semi-regular Sandra Ferguson), bounty diploma in hand, applies for, and gets, a job with Sixkiller Enterprises, based on her purchase and completion of the Sixkiller video. Sean "Too Short" Shimmel: Jimm Giannini.

5.2: "Self Defense"

Reno goes after bounty Teddy Ray Thompson (Linda Blair), who accidently stabbed her cop husband during a situation of domestic abuse. But when Reno discovers the truth, he finds a kindred spirit in Teddy Ray, and helps her fend off her husband's partner (Joe Cortese), who's determined to get his revenge.

5.3: "Mr. Success"

Reno, Bobby and Sandy attempt to trackdown "Chick" Raymond (Billy Ray Sharky) after a former lover (Ronnie Brewster) asks them to find Raymond so he can take responisbility for the baby he fathered 6 years ago. But trouble erupts when Raymond is promptly killed. Meanwhile, Bobby goes ga-ga over a visit from his inspiration "Mr. Success", Derrick Devlin (David Leisure).

5.4: "Five Minutes Til Midnight"

Bobby gets a message from his first bounty, Bruce Cassidy (Scott Valentine), a man on death row for multiple rape/murders; it's a case that Bobby has always had doubts about. So Bobby, with Reno in pursuit, decides to investigate whether Cassidy really is innocent, and ends up smack dab in the middle of a mystery, stonewalled all the way by Cassidy's attorney (Lora Zane) and a Deputy District Attorney (William Anton).

5.5: "God's Mistake"

Reno tracks a rock star who faked his own disappearance.

5.6: "Ghost Story"

After Reno is shot and nearly dies, the ghostly apparition of Neil Kirby (Ken Olandt) follows Reno back from "The Great Beyond" because he wants Reno to restore his reputation with his widow (Yvonne Suhor) and son (Keith Okie), and because he wants to help catch the man, a hood named Skylar (Scott Kraft), that caused his death, and who just happens to be the bounty who shot Reno in the first place.

5.7: "The Milk Carton Kid"

Sandy is approached by a 10 year-old girl named Molly (Ashley Buccille) who has seen her picture on a milk carton and who is convinced her parents are kidnappers. But what starts out a simple background check quickly spirals into a convoluted mess involving the girl, the girl's "parents" (John Mariano, Elizabeth Heflin), Sandy, Reno, Bobby, the FBI and the Mob.

5.8: "High Rollers"

Reno and Bobby are hired to go to Reno, NV by Bobby's friend Dan Travis (Frankie Avalon) who owns a casino and whose big winners are getting robbed by a band of highway robbers; Reno and Bobby's job: to catch this pirate crew.

5.9: "For Better, For Worse"

While Dutch tries to juggle shaking down a pornographer (Larry Manetti) and pleasing his boss (Kent McCord), his wife, Melissa (Gloria Loring), finally decides that enough is enough, so she goes to Bobby and Reno and offers to help take Dutch down.

5.10: "The Pipeline"

When Reno comes across an old bounty of Bobby's who is supposed to be dead, he and Bobby start an investigation, and soon stumble upon "The Pipeline", an organization which makes criminals disappear, provided they meet certain requirements. So, Bobby enlists the help of his original assistant, a woman named Kate (Charlotte Lewis), who now runs a security business that is even larger than Sizkiller Enterprises, which brings up some envy and resentment from Bobby. Oh, and lastly, Bobby is audited by the IRS!

5.11: "Ransom"

When Bobby turns a bounty down, snitch/informant Tony O'Malley (Terry Camilleri; from episode #4.15) goes out after the bounty, "The Undie-Bomber", a bank robber named Travis Taylor (Judson Mills) who robs banks with fake bombs. But O'Malley soon messes up and ends up kidnapped by Taylor, meaning Bobby must pay the ransom to get him back.

5.12: "Father's Day"

Reno's old flame (pre-Val) appeals for help when her ex-boyfriend gets out of jail and begins stalking her, but, in the course of helping her, Reno discovers that she has a son and that the son may be his, but Bobby and Sandy are dubious. So the question is: is the boy really Reno's?

5.13: "Hard Rain"

It turns out that "Dutch" Dixon's security consultant bugged Dutch's house and has a tape of Dutch killing his wife, Melissa Dixon, which he offers to Bobby in return for Bobby's killing an Arizona mobster. Meanwhile, Dutch's boss (Kent McCord) insists that Dutch go to the squad pyschologist.

5.14: "Top Ten With a Bullet"

Reno and Bobby decide to go after "#4" on the FBI's "Most Wanted List": a former 60's radical who planted a bomb an blew up a fellow Professor back in the late 60's and who's been on the run ever since.

5.15: "SWM Seeks Vctm"

After Sandy's discovers her good friend murdered, after taking out a personal ad, Sandy is tipped off that a serial killer may be invovled when the FBI are the ones that arrive to investigate, but she decides to inestigate on her own, a prospect that worries Bobby.

5.16: "Knockout"

[This synopsis is editted from a version by Audrey DeLisle ([email protected]).]
A producer hires Reno and Bobby to find his kickboxing heroine, who has vanished during the filming of a picture with the only clue, a card with a dragon emblem.

5.17: "Sex, Lies and Activewear"

Bobby has another "brilliant" business idea: making "action lingere" with a partner, Bobby's personal trainer Lake Bradshaw (season #5 semi-regular Shauna Sands). But things go terribly wrong when a couple of bumbling burglers (Jay Avocone, Christopher Michael Moore) take the photo shoot for "Playpen" magazine hostage, including the models (Renee Tenison, Shae Marks), Lake, and the Photo Editor of Playpen (Arlene Dahl; Note: Dahl is playing a different character than her previous appearance in episode #3.19).

5.18: "Blood Hunt"

When Reno comes across a runaway (Virginya Keehne) who looks like she's going to be the fourth victim of a "vampire" in a beach community, Reno investigates further, suspicious of a "supernatural" cause.

5.19: "Bounty Hunter of the Year"

Bobby is to receive an award: Bounty Hunter of the Year. The problem: he's having trouble coming up with a speech. So he, Reno and Sandy mull over Bobby's bounty-hunting career to find an appropriate case for his speech. A retorspective episode.

5.20: "Born Under a Bad Sign"

Reno catches a $50,000 bounty namd Fenton Boggs (Jeremy Roberts), but Bobby tells Reno to let Boggs go: it seems that Boggs is a well- known jinx. Of course, Reno doesn't believe in such thing, that is until Reno and Boggs *both* end up in jail.

5.21: "The Maltese Indian"

Bobby, Sandy and Reno stake out the ex-girlfriend and daughter (Kathrin Nicholson, Brittany Alyse Smith) of a deadly escaped convict and bank robber (Todd Tesen), whose hidden stash of gold may net Sixkiller Enterprises a $150,000 reward, and it's not long before Reno ingratiates himself with both the ex-girlfriend and the daughter.

5.22: "The Bad Seed"

While Dutch makes one last offer to Reno (through Bobby): leave the country and receive $500,000 from Dutch to stay quiet, Donnie Dixon (Steven Flynn; also in episodes #3.9 and #4.11) escapes prison to seek revenge on his mother's killer (whom Donnie thinks is Reno) after the apparition of his Mother (Gloria Loring) visits him in prison. Meanwhile, Dutch's boss Jack Hendricks (Kent McCord) tries to sort it all out, in an exicting outing that may be the concluding episode of the "Renegade" series.
